分析了大功率逆變電源IGBT關斷時產生電壓尖峰的機理,并對影響電壓尖峰的主要因素進行了分 析。通過應用疊層復合母排可以降低主電路母線的分布電感,設計合理的吸收電路能夠改善開關器件的開關軌跡, 抑制尖峰電壓,使開關器件運行在可靠的工作范圍內。仿真結果驗證了吸收電路的有效性。
上傳時間: 2013-05-25
上傳用戶:pwcsoft
隨著電子技術的發展,當前數字系統的設計正朝著速度快、容量大、體積小、重量輕的方向發展.FPGA以其功能強大,開發過程投資少、周期短,可反復修改,保密性能好,開發工具智能化等特點成為當今硬件設計的首選方式之一.由于Intel公司的MCS-51系列單片機被公認為8位機的工業標準,因此,使用FPGA模擬實現8051單片機及其外設的功能便成為大規模復雜數字系統設計中的重要課題.該文首先介紹了FPGA及Xilinx公司關于硬件設計開發的工具ISE系統,繼而用VHDL語言編寫了8051單片機功能實現的源代碼,然后為其設計了與部分外設連接的接口模塊,包括8255并行接口、SCI串行接口和KBC鍵盤接口模塊.并將它們封裝到一塊FPGA之中,最終實現了8051單片機的大部分功能.
上傳時間: 2013-07-28
上傳用戶:erkuizhang
信息技術的不斷發展,對信息的安全提出了更高的要求.在應用公鑰密碼體制的時候,對密鑰長度要求越來越大,處理的速度要求越來越快.而基于橢圓曲線離散對數問題的橢圓曲線密碼體制,因其每比特最大的安全性,受到了越來越廣泛的注意.橢圓曲線密碼體制(ECC:Elliptic Curve Cryptosystem)的快速實現也成為一個關注的方面.該文按照確定有限域、選取曲線參數、劃分結構模塊、優化模塊算法、實現模塊設計,驗證模塊功能的順序進行書寫.為了硬件實現上的方便,設計選擇了含有Ⅱ型優化正規基的伽略域GF(2191),并在該域上構造了隨機的橢圓曲線.根據層次化、結構化的設計思路,將橢圓曲線上的標量乘法運算劃分成兩個運算層次:橢圓曲線上的運算和有限域上的運算.模塊劃分之后,利用自底向上的設計思路,主要針對有限域上的乘法運算進行了重要的改進,并對加法群中的標量乘運算的算法進行了分析、證明,以達到面積優化和快速執行的效果.具體設計中,采用硬件描述語言Verilog HDL,在Mentor Graphics公司出品的FPGA Advantage平臺上進行電路設計.完成了各個模塊的設計輸入和仿真.設計選用了Altera公司的APEX Ⅱ系列器件,利用第一方軟件Quartus Ⅱ 2.2進行綜合、布局、布線和時序仿真.文中給出了橢圓曲線上的點加、倍點和標量乘法模塊的具體設計結構框圖.并且根據橢圓曲線的標量乘特點,提出了合適的驗證方案.該設計完成了橢圓曲線上的標量乘法運算.設計主要針對資源受限的應用環境:改進了有限域上的乘法運算、使用了沒有預處理的標量乘算法.改進后的橢圓曲線標量乘法需要2,741,998個邏輯單元,在100MHz的時鐘約束下,運行一次標量乘法運算需要567.69us.該次設計的結果可以直接用來構造橢圓曲線上的簽名、驗證、密鑰交換等算法.
上傳時間: 2013-05-24
上傳用戶:zhuo0008
嵌入式系統是一種將底層硬件、實時操作系統和應用軟件相結合的專用計算機系統,在經濟社會和人們的日常生活中得到了越來越廣泛的應用。嵌入式系統的研究與開發已成為現代電子領域的重要研究方向之一。嵌入式實時操作系統是嵌入式系統應用軟件開發的支撐平臺,網絡化是主要趨勢之一。 μC/OS-Ⅱ作為一種新興的嵌入式實時操作系統,以其免費公開源碼、面向中小型應用、可搶占、多任務以及較好的移植性等突出特點,在各類嵌入式設備中得到廣泛應用。然而,μC/OS-Ⅱ內核中不支持TCP/IP協議棧,因而無法適應嵌入式設備網絡化的需要。本文的主要目標是:在計算資源嚴重受限的條件下,研究使嵌入式系統支持TCP/IP協議的策略及其實現方法。 本課題以實驗室現有的Samsung S3C44BOX芯片為核心的ARM開發板作為硬件平臺,分析了ARM7TDM[內核的特點及S3C44BOX的結構。在詳細分析實時操作系統μC/OS-Ⅱ及其內核原理的基礎上對其進行適當的改進并成功移植到ARM硬件平臺上。針對μC/OS-Ⅱ內核不支持TCP/IP協議棧的問題,引進了嵌入式TCP/IP協議uIP,將其應用到μC/OS-Ⅱ上,成為μC/OS-Ⅱ的網絡服務模塊,實現了對μC/OS-Ⅱ的網絡功能的擴充,并在uIP基礎上編寫了相關的網絡驅動程序。最后,本課題設計了基于HTTP協議的嵌入式Web服務器和基于TFTP協議的遠程文件傳輸,從而使網絡遠程監控測量和在線程序的更新下載成為現實。 本課題經過數月的軟硬件的設計和調試,已實現了最初的設計目標。測試結果表明:移植到ARM處理器上的μC/OS-Ⅱ內核可以成功實現對任務的調度;對μC/OS-Ⅱ內核擴充的TCP/IP協議——uIP可正常運行:嵌入式Web服務器和遠、程文件傳輸在實驗室局域網中的穩定運行,更加證明了本課題的成功性。
上傳時間: 2013-05-17
上傳用戶:LSPSL
本文對基于脈動陣列結構的RSA公鑰密碼協處理器進行了深入的研究,通過對Montgomery模乘思想的深入分析,確定了免減基2算法作為模乘運算實現算法,同時系統的研究了脈動陣列結構這一專用處理器設計模型,結合器件特性設計出一種適于在FPGA上實現的模乘運算電路結構,通過引入流水線技術,實現了兩次模乘運算并行處理。在此基礎上,引入可變參數的設計理念,完成了可變參數模冪運算電路的設計與實現工作,有效的提高了算法硬件實現的靈活性。
上傳時間: 2013-07-16
上傳用戶:playboys0
隨著計算機和信息技術的飛速發展,信息的安全性越來越受到人們的重視。敏感信息的電子化在使用戶得到便利的同時,數據、資源免泄漏也成為了人們必須注意的一個大隱患。在這個信息全球化的時代,病毒、黑客、電子竊聽欺騙、網絡攻擊都是人們所必須面對的重大問題。出于這種需要,加密自然吸引了人們的注意力,而傳統的軟件加密技術已經越來越不能滿足信息安全對運算速度和系統安全性的需求,硬件設施的開發顯示出其重要性,硬件加密模塊的地位也越來越重要。但其安全性仍存在著一定的問題,對安全性研究仍是不可放松的一個重要問題。 本文介紹了目前幾種流行加密算法及標準,并對典型的公鑰密碼標準RSA進一步說明。RSA算法可以進行數字簽名、數據加/解密,將其應用于數據安全領域具有很大的意義。針對于目前硬件加解密相對于軟件加解密的種種優勢,論文重點研究RSA算法的基于硬件FPGA的設計實現方案。FPGA是近幾年的超大規模集成電路設計的焦點,其速度及成本等都占有一定的優勢。對RSA算法的FPGA設計,論文主要研究兩方面的內容:密鑰生成部分中的素數檢測問題和加/解密算法中關鍵瓶頸--大數模乘及模冪運算。并進行了軟硬件的仿真、驗證與測試。論文對RSA設計模塊的可應用領域之一--智能卡及其安全性做了簡單的介紹,并對論文所研究實現的模塊在其中的應用進行了說明,從而體現了其實際應用價值。
上傳時間: 2013-07-06
上傳用戶:juyuantwo
BGA布線指南 BGA CHIP PLACEMENT AND ROUTING RULE BGA是PCB上常用的組件,通常CPU、NORTH BRIDGE、SOUTH BRIDGE、AGP CHIP、CARD BUS CHIP…等,大多是以bga的型式包裝,簡言之,80﹪的高頻信號及特殊信號將會由這類型的package內拉出。因此,如何處理BGA package的走線,對重要信號會有很大的影響。 通常環繞在BGA附近的小零件,依重要性為優先級可分為幾類: 1. by pass。 2. clock終端RC電路。 3. damping(以串接電阻、排組型式出現;例如memory BUS信號) 4. EMI RC電路(以dampin、C、pull height型式出現;例如USB信號)。 5. 其它特殊電路(依不同的CHIP所加的特殊電路;例如CPU的感溫電路)。 6. 40mil以下小電源電路組(以C、L、R等型式出現;此種電路常出現在AGP CHIP or含AGP功能之CHIP附近,透過R、L分隔出不同的電源組)。 7. pull low R、C。 8. 一般小電路組(以R、C、Q、U等型式出現;無走線要求)。 9. pull height R、RP。 中文DOC,共5頁,圖文并茂
上傳時間: 2013-04-24
上傳用戶:cxy9698
·源碼公開的MCS 51 單片機的宏匯編器 Macro Assembler of MCS MCS-51 micro controller Version 0.12 這是一個應屆生寫的習作 盡管這個軟件A51 還未完全達到滿意的效果不過與Keil 公司的A51 配合起來使用還是不錯的 公開源碼和文檔的目的是希望能夠給一些愛好者作為學習編譯原理和C 程序設計的靶子同時也希望有更多的熱心人參與修改源碼直至
上傳時間: 2013-07-23
上傳用戶:xjz632
ARM開發板原理圖和PCB,ARM7公版。
上傳時間: 2013-06-02
上傳用戶:fanboynet
一、 尺寸:長63mmX寬48mmX高16mm 二、 主要芯片:FR1205(NMOS) 三、 輸入控制電壓:直流5V 輸出控制電壓12V~55V,電流為44A 四、串口下載程序 五、 特點: 1、輸入控制電源與被控電源隔離 2、具有四路輸出信號指示。 3、具有四路光耦隔離 4、四路輸入信號低電平有效時有效 5、輸入使用排針可方便與單片機設備相連 6、輸出使用接線端子可方便接被控設備供電電源 7、輸出可控制5—55V直流電源
上傳時間: 2013-10-09
上傳用戶:zhf01y